    Can anyone suggest a way to batch accelerate the speed of video files.

    I tried Vegas, but the audio remains the same... unaccepatable.

    It would be great if the pitch can remain the same so that the audio is understandable upon playback. I use goldwave, a GREAT freeware program to batch conv audio files... but need something similar that can do the same for video.

    You can use a combination of the velocity envelope and time stretch (audio event properties to set it) to change both. Time Stretch changes the speed without pitch shifting.
